特斯拉(Tesla)作为电动汽车和自动驾驶技术的领军企业,不仅在产品性能上追求卓越,更在安全领域持续创新。其中,特斯拉的TLSA技术(Transport Layer Security with Authentication)便是其安全之道的重要组成部分。本文将深入解析特斯拉TLSA技术的原理、优势及其在保障信息安全方面的作用。
一、TLSA技术概述
TLSA,即传输层安全性验证,是一种用于验证TLS(传输层安全性)证书的技术。在传统的TLS协议中,客户端与服务器之间的通信加密主要依赖于证书的验证。然而,由于中间人攻击等安全威胁的存在,TLS证书的验证过程变得尤为重要。TLSA技术正是为了解决这一问题而诞生的。
二、TLSA技术的工作原理
证书颁发过程:当特斯拉的服务器需要获取TLS证书时,它会向证书颁发机构(CA)申请。在申请过程中,特斯拉的服务器会提供其公钥指纹(Public Key Fingerprint)。
公钥指纹验证:CA在颁发证书前,会对特斯拉提供的公钥指纹进行验证,确保其与服务器身份相符。
TLSA记录:一旦证书颁发成功,CA会在证书中包含一个TLSA记录,该记录包含了特斯拉服务器的公钥指纹和证书的序列号。
客户端验证:当客户端尝试连接特斯拉的服务器时,它会通过TLS协议获取服务器的证书。随后,客户端会使用TLSA记录中的信息,对证书中的公钥指纹和证书序列号进行验证。
三、TLSA技术的优势
增强安全性:TLSA技术可以有效防止中间人攻击,确保客户端与服务器之间的通信安全。
简化证书管理:通过TLSA技术,服务器可以简化证书管理过程,降低运维成本。
提高用户体验:TLSA技术可以减少证书验证过程中的延迟,从而提高用户体验。
四、特斯拉TLSA技术的应用实例
特斯拉云服务:特斯拉的云服务使用TLSA技术,确保了客户端与服务器之间的通信安全。
特斯拉移动应用:特斯拉的移动应用也采用了TLSA技术,保障了用户数据的安全。
特斯拉充电网络:特斯拉的充电网络同样使用了TLSA技术,确保了充电过程中的信息安全。
五、总结
特斯拉TLSA技术作为一项重要的安全创新,在保障信息安全方面发挥了重要作用。随着网络安全的日益重要,相信TLSA技术将在更多领域得到应用,为用户提供更加安全、可靠的通信体验。